Background
Pervez Productions was a film studio owned by director M. Pervez.

1st Logo (January 2, 1966-February 27, 1969)
Logo We slowly zoom out from a painted cloudy sky. Suddenly, some white Urdu text appears and zooms out, comtaining the company name and the word "PRESENTS!".
Technique: Camera-controlled animation.
Audio: A dramatic fanfare with the last note choppily repeated. An announcer is heard talking through the middle.
Availability: Seen on Maidaan and Sau Din Chor Da.
2nd Logo (March 14, 1975, July 23, 1982)
Logo Almost the same as above, but the sky is in a different setting and now filmed in love-action. The logo is also in color and the Urdu text is in yellow. It moves back two seconds later, and then disappears, and then fades to black.
Variant: On Chardha Suraj, the sky is more "natural" colored.
Technique: Live-action for the sky background, and camera-controlled animation for the text.
Audio: Same as above, but extended. Chardha Suraj has the first part cut out.
Availability: Seen on Ser Da Badla and Chardha Suraj.
3rd Logo (November 12, 1978-1991?)
The video of this logo may be too loud or severely distorted. |
Visuals: A view of a rural area is shown from below. The camera then faces up into the sky, as some red Urdu text appears in front.
Technique: Live-action with a fading effect for the red text.
Audio: Same as before.
Availability: Seen on Sanjhi Hathkari, Khana Jungi, Boycott, Lal Toofan and Sher Medan Da.
